Responsible for assisting in the orderly operation of the Community Center front desk, utilizing clerical/receptionist skills while dealing with the public and co-workers. REQUIRED EDUCATION, QUALIFICATIONS, K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ES Minimum of high school diploma or equivalent with at least 6 months experience in general office duties, strong computer skills and experience dealing with the public required. Must possess an aptitude for learning a multi-layered software application. Must have great problem solving, analytical, organizational, interpersonal; and written and verbal communication skills. Must be able to multi-task and work calmly and effectively under pressure.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S Perform all Rec-Trac software related duties utilizing activity, pass, POS, and facility modules. Process registrations; including answering inquires, customer transfers, handling paperwork and collecting of fees as required. Monitor and follow up with all online e-mail questions. Demonstrate acquired knowledge of Wheaton Park District facilities, parks, and programs. Direct patrons to specific Community Center locations. General clerical work that may include typing and word processing. Open office and secure office upon closing. Accurately file documents and reports. Utilize OneNote to stay informed of changes and updates by reading every shift. Follow the Wheaton Park District policies, procedures, and guidelines. Provide a high quality of customer service in a professional manner to the internal customer that will facilitate team building and exceptional customer service to the external customer Proactively support the V.A.L.U.E.S. (integrity, fun, commitment, adaptability and growth, kindness, and service) on a daily basis. Maintain good safety awareness and follow all safety guidelines and procedures. REQUIRED CERTIFICATIONS, LICENSES, ETC. CPR/AED certified or obtain within one (1) year of employment. PHYSICAL DEMANDS Must be able to: frequently sit for long periods of time, with repetitive use of hands/arms such as when using a computer and occasionally move items such as boxes of catalogues, bags of sports equipment, etc. weighing up to 25 lbs. ENVIRONMENTAL DEMANDS This position must be able to handle all weather conditions while traveling between facilities and work frequently in an office environment with moderate to loud noise levels. HOURS Monday - 4:45 a.m. to 9:00 a.m. Tuesday and Thursday: 9:30 a.m. - 2:00 p.m. SALARY $15.00-$17.00 per hour SALARY RANGE Minimum - Midpoint - Maximum $15.00 - $18.75 - $22.50 The Wheaton Park District is an equal opportunity employer.
